## Description

PLEASE READ THIS NOTICE CAREFULLY AS IT CONSTITUTES THE ONLY NOTICE THAT WILL BE PUBLISHED. The Federal Bureau of Investigation (FBI) intends to negotiate a one-time, sole source, firm-fixed-price (FFP) contract to LAUDA-Brinkmann, LP, (CAGE Code 5K1Y2), 9 East Stow Road, Suite C, Marlton, New Jersey, 08073 for one (1) LAUDA Integral IN 150 XT temperature control machine (chiller/heater), and supplies.

This notice will be distributed solely through the General Services Administration's System for Awards Management website (https://sam.gov/). Interested parties are responsible for monitoring the site to ensure they have the most up-to-date information about this acquisition. The North American Classification System Code is 334516, Analytical Laboratory Instrument Manufacturing; and the Product Service Code, 6640, Laboratory Equipment and Supplies.

The FBI intends to negotiate with only one source under the authority of FAR 6.302-1. This notice of intent is not a request for competitive quotations; however, responsible sources may submit a capability statement, proposal, or quotation, which shall be considered by the agency. This notice of intent is not a request for competitive quotations; however, interested parties may identify their interests and/or capabilities statement to this requirement by contacting Contracting Officer, Bryan Lane at bvlane@fbi.gov.

Responses submitted utilizing other means will not be considered. Telephone requests will not be considered. Information received will be used solely to determine whether to conduct a competitive procurement. A determination by the government not to compete this proposed contract based upon responses to this notice is at the discretion of the Government. No reimbursement for any cost connected with providing capability information will be provided.
